Bradley Stoke could be the home to yet another recycling centre (or in old language, rubbish dump) after it was revealed the Stoke Gifford centre was being used too much!
The admission came after The Evening Post ran a story claiming height barriers had been put up at the centre is Stoke Gifford to cut down on trade use.
The report claims South Gloucestershire Council spokeswoman, Debra Davies, said the council “was looking for land to build an alternative site on, possibly in the Bradley Stoke area”.
“A larger plot of land is still being sought to build a better and larger site to meet the needs of the area,” she told the newspaper.
Quite where South Gloucestershire Council thinks it can find land to build this facility is Bradley Stoke is beyond this publication.
There are many downsides, of course, to having a dump on your doorstep: Increased traffic, bad smells … We could go on. Let’s hope they see sense and build it away from any houses.
